The 2026 Harley-Davidson® CVO™ Street Glide® 3 Limited is a three-wheel touring model designed around a combination of large-displacement V-Twin power, integrated rider technology, long-distance comfort features, and advanced control systems. Identified as the FLHLTSE, this model incorporates the Milwaukee-Eight® VVT 121 engine, a six-speed transmission with reverse functionality, a purpose-built chassis, and a comprehensive collection of electronic rider aids.

Engine and Powertrain

The 2026 Harley-Davidson® CVO™ Street Glide® 3 Limited is powered by the Milwaukee-Eight® VVT 121 engine, a large-displacement V-Twin with a displacement of 121 cubic inches, or 1,977 cc. The engine uses pushrod-operated overhead valves with hydraulic self-adjusting lifters and four valves per cylinder. This valve train configuration reduces routine adjustment requirements while supporting consistent operation across a broad operating range. Engine dimensions include a 4.075-inch bore and a 4.625-inch stroke. The engine operates with an 11.4:1 compression ratio and utilizes Electronic Sequential Port Fuel Injection (ESPFI) for fuel delivery.

Supporting systems contribute to the engine's overall functionality and operating efficiency. A synthetic felt washable air cleaner is used for intake filtration, while a 2-1-2 dual exhaust system manages exhaust flow. Lubrication is handled through a pressurized dry-sump system that separates oil storage from the crankcase. This configuration supports consistent oil circulation throughout engine operation.

Output and Torque Characteristics

Performance figures reflect the substantial displacement and engineering of the Milwaukee-Eight® VVT 121 engine. Using the J1349 testing method, the engine produces 138 ft-lb of torque at 3,750 rpm. Peak power is rated at 114 horsepower, or 85 kW, at 4,500 rpm. The available torque supports acceleration and load-carrying capability while maintaining smooth operation across the transmission's gear range.

The engine's torque curve works in conjunction with the six-speed transmission to provide flexible power delivery. Producing maximum torque at a relatively moderate engine speed allows the powertrain to operate effectively during a wide range of riding conditions.

Transmission and Driveline Systems

The drivetrain incorporates a six-speed Cruise Drive® transmission equipped with reverse capability. This configuration provides six forward gear ratios along with an electrically actuated reverse system controlled through handlebar-mounted hand controls. Reverse functionality is particularly useful when maneuvering a vehicle of this size and weight in parking areas or confined spaces. The transmission is paired with a mechanically actuated 10-plate wet Assist and Slip clutch.

Power is transferred through a chain primary drive with a 34/46 ratio and a belt final drive with a 30/70 ratio. Gear ratios are specified at 10.534 in first gear, 7.302 in second gear, 5.423 in third gear, 4.392 in fourth gear, 3.742 in fifth gear, and 3.000 in sixth gear. The progression between ratios supports a gradual transition through the gearbox while maintaining efficient power delivery.

Chassis Architecture and Vehicle Dimensions

The chassis of the 2026 Harley-Davidson® CVO™ Street Glide® 3 Limited is built around a mild steel square-section backbone frame with twin downtubes. This structure provides the foundation for the vehicle's suspension, powertrain, and body components. Complementing the frame is a permanent mold cast aluminum swingarm that contributes to the overall chassis design. Steering geometry consists of a 26-degree rake, a 32-degree fork angle, and 3.8 inches of trail. 

Vehicle dimensions reflect the substantial touring-oriented layout of the model. Overall length measures 105.7 inches, while overall width is 57.3 inches, and overall height is 56.5 inches. The wheelbase spans 67.7 inches, contributing to the platform's overall stance. Laden seat height is 27.3 inches, while unladen seat height measures 28.9 inches. Static ground clearance is specified at 5.1 inches, providing clearance between the chassis and the riding surface.

Weight Ratings and Storage Capacity

The 2026 Harley-Davidson® CVO™ Street Glide® 3 Limited has an as-shipped weight of 1,243 pounds and a running-order weight of 1,283 pounds. Gross Vehicle Weight Rating is specified at 1,700 pounds. Gross Axle Weight Ratings are 511 pounds for the front axle and 1,189 pounds for the rear axle.

Storage capability is supported by a luggage volume of 7.1 cubic feet. Fuel capacity measures 6 gallons, while the reserve fuel capacity associated with the warning light is 1 gallon. Additional service capacities include 5 quarts of engine oil with filter, 1.22 quarts of transmission fluid, 1.1 quarts for the primary chain case, and 0.82 quarts of coolant.

Suspension, Wheels, and Tire Configuration

The suspension system combines a dual bending valve front fork with a hand-adjustable rear suspension. The front fork measures 49 mm, or 1.9 inches, in diameter and is designed to manage front-end suspension movement and steering inputs. At the rear, hand-adjustable emulsion shocks allow suspension settings to be adjusted according to rider preferences or operating conditions. Front suspension travel is specified at 4.6 inches, while rear suspension travel measures 3.46 inches.

Wheel construction features Dual Grain Chrome 14-spoke designs at both the front and rear. The front wheel measures 19 inches in diameter and 3.5 inches in width. The rear wheel measures 18 inches in diameter and 7 inches in width. These wheel dimensions support the vehicle's chassis configuration while accommodating the specified tire package.

Tire Specifications

The tire package consists of Dunlop® Harley-Davidson® Series tires. The front tire uses a bias blackwall construction and is identified as a D408F. Its specification is 130/60B19 M/C 61H. The rear tire uses a radial blackwall design and is identified as a TK100. Rear tire sizing is specified as P215/45R18 83T.

Braking Systems and Rider Control Technologies

The braking system combines substantial hardware with electronic rider-assistance technology. Front braking uses 32 mm four-piston fixed calipers, while the rear system uses a floating 36 mm piston caliper with an integrated park brake. Dual floating rotors are used at the front, and a fixed rotor is used at the rear. Front and rear rotor diameters are both specified at 11.8 inches. Rotor thickness measures 0.197 inch at the front and 0.276 inch at the rear.

Standard Anti-Lock Braking System functionality is integrated into the vehicle's braking package. Electronic Linked Braking is also included, helping coordinate braking inputs through the system. The combination of mechanical components and electronic controls provides a comprehensive braking package that supports predictable operation and rider confidence.

Rider Safety Enhancements

The 2026 Harley-Davidson® CVO™ Street Glide® 3 Limited includes a broad suite of rider safety technologies. Standard systems include Anti-Lock Braking System, Electronic Linked Braking, Traction Control System, Drag-torque Slip Control System, Vehicle Hold Control, and Tire Pressure Monitoring System.

Cornering-focused safety technologies expand the available rider-assistance package. Included systems consist of Cornering Enhanced Anti-Lock Brake System, Cornering Enhanced Electronic Linked Braking, Cornering Enhanced Traction Control System, and Cornering Drag-Torque Slip Control System. These systems adapt their operation to account for cornering conditions.

Electrical Systems and Functional Equipment

Electrical power is supplied by a sealed, maintenance-free 12-volt battery rated at 28 amp-hours and 405 cold-cranking amps. Charging duties are handled by a three-phase 48-amp system capable of producing 600 watts at 13 volts and 2,000 rpm, with maximum output rated at 625 watts at 13 volts. The engine features a 1.6 kW electric starter with solenoid-shift starter engagement.

Lighting throughout the vehicle utilizes LED technology. The headlamp, tail and stop lamp, front signal lamps, and rear turn signals all use LED illumination. Additional LED fog lamps are integrated into the lower fairings. This lighting configuration contributes to visibility and supports the vehicle's integrated equipment package. Digital gauges are incorporated directly into the display system, centralizing vehicle information within the rider's field of view.

Navigation and Convenience Features

The vehicle includes an embedded navigation system with GPS functionality. Navigation capability incorporates traffic and weather information through a Wi-Fi hotspot connection. A 15-watt USB-C electric power accessory port is located within the media storage box, providing a dedicated charging and connectivity point.

Electric reverse is another notable convenience feature integrated into the model. The system is controlled through handlebar-mounted hand controls and is designed to assist during low-speed maneuvering. Combined with the navigation system and integrated power outlet, this functionality contributes to the vehicle's overall usability and convenience.

Infotainment and Connectivity

The infotainment system operates on Skyline™ OS and utilizes a 12.3-inch full-color TFT display. This display serves as the central interface for information, entertainment, and connectivity functions. Digital gauges are integrated into the display environment, allowing vehicle information to be viewed through a centralized screen.

Audio performance is supported through a six-speaker configuration. The system includes two 6.5-inch fairing speakers, two 6.5-inch Tour-Pak® speakers, and two 6.5-inch lower fairing speakers. Output specifications include 50 watts per channel as well as a system configuration rated at 125 watts across four channels and 150 watts across two channels. AM and FM radio functionality are included as standard equipment.

Device Integration and Communications

Connectivity features support a broad range of communication and media functions. Hands-free mobile phone connectivity through Bluetooth® is standard. Bluetooth® capability also supports media player and headset connections. Rider and passenger intercom functionality is included, with VOX capability available for compatible H-D headsets.

Additional connectivity options include support for SD cards, flash drives, and MP3 playback through USB connections. The USB-C and MTP-compatible connection supports smartphone integration when proper adapters are used. Phone connectivity includes Apple CarPlay® through either wired or wireless operation.
